Output ef6c1bf1fdde69f788c37b03a6f831cec21a8f6662e3bfa47e3cc04944e68bc6:1

value
2557427
script pubkey
OP_0 OP_PUSHBYTES_20 bd80a97f5b38fb0e51da9526a7ad551b568b101a
address
bc1qhkq2jl6m8rasu5w6j5n20t24rdtgkyq672qmyh
transaction
ef6c1bf1fdde69f788c37b03a6f831cec21a8f6662e3bfa47e3cc04944e68bc6
confirmations
142824
spent
true